私たちのアプリでは、firebase.jsonで指定されたパブリックディレクトリにいくつかのHTMLファイルが含まれています。 メインは「index.html」と呼ばれ、その他は「index-full.html」と「facebook-channel.html」です。 「firebasedeploy」の後、「index-full.html」がデフォルトのインデックスファイルになり、次のURLはすべて同じファイル「index-full.html」のコンテンツを読み込みます。
「index-full.html」の名前が「index-full.html-off」に変更された場合、正しい「index.html」がデフォルトのインデックスファイルとして選択されます。
これは、アップロードされたファイルに対してこのベータ版のプロトタイプを作成するために使用しているプロバイダーの後処理に関係しているのではないかと思います。 この機能は間もなく削除されるか、少なくとも無効にできるように取り組んでいます。
お待ち頂きまして、ありがとうございます
ご回答いただきありがとうございます。Firebaseホスティングは優れたサービスであり、これらの小さな展開の不具合を簡単に回避できました。
これは修正されるはずです。 興味を持ってくれてありがとう
こんにちは、
Webアプリをデプロイできません。デプロイ済みと表示されますが、アプリが表示されません。 標準のindex.htmlウェルカムページが表示されます。 独自のindex.htmlページを作成する必要がありますか? create-react-appを使用しています。
ありがとうございました
@ azucenareyesfirebase.jsonファイルを確認します。 「public」:「public」から「public」:「app」 、またはアプリのコンテンツが存在するその他のディレクトリの行を編集します。 それはあなたを助けます。
問題は、firebaseがインデックスファイルを作成しているときに、reactによって作成されたものを上書きすることです。 したがって、すべてのFirebaseコードを実行し(デプロイを除く)、「npm run build」を再実行して、ビルドディレクトリに必要なインデックスファイルを再作成するように反応させてから、 firebase.json
"ホスティングを変更する必要があります。 「ビルド」への「ブロックの「公開」キー。 (特にreactの場合、これがデフォルトのディレクトリです。)最後に、デプロイでき、すべてが正しいはずです。 (手作業がどれだけかかるかを除いて。)
最も参考になるコメント
問題は、firebaseがインデックスファイルを作成しているときに、reactによって作成されたものを上書きすることです。 したがって、すべてのFirebaseコードを実行し(デプロイを除く)、「npm run build」を再実行して、ビルドディレクトリに必要なインデックスファイルを再作成するように反応させてから、
firebase.json
"ホスティングを変更する必要があります。 「ビルド」への「ブロックの「公開」キー。 (特にreactの場合、これがデフォルトのディレクトリです。)最後に、デプロイでき、すべてが正しいはずです。 (手作業がどれだけかかるかを除いて。)